AARP Tax Assistance

Do you need help with your taxes? Make an appointment with Patty, an AARP representative, to get the ball rolling. 

Appointments are mandatory

The AARP team will be at the East Providence Senior Center every Monday from Feb. 6, 2023 - April 10, 2023

THINGS TO BRING TO YOUR APPOINTMENT:

BEFORE YOUR APPOINTMENT, PLEASE READ AND SIGN ALL CONSENT FORMS AND ANSWER ALL QUESTIONS ON THE INTAKE FORM

FOR DIRECT DEPOSIT—BRING CHECKBOOK OR BANK ROUTING AND ACCOUNT. COPY OF CHECK IS BEST

MULTIPLE EXPENSES FOR DEDUCTIONS SHOULD BE ADDED AND SUMMARIZED ON A SHEET

ALL ENVELOPES SHOULD BE OPENED AND PAPERWORK ORGANIZED

NO BUSINESS RETURNS PREPARED EXCEPT FOR SCHEDULE C

ONLY 1 RETURN PER APPOINTMENT

ITEMS TO BRING:

  • Photo ID, Driver’s License, Last Year’s Tax Return
  • Social Security Card for taxpayer, spouse and dependents
  • Birth Dates for taxpayer, spouse and dependents
  • W2-Wages/Earnings
  • W2-G Gambling Winnings
  • 1099G Unemployment
  • 1099R Pension/Annuity
  • SSA-1099 Social Security Statement (Has a Pink Box)
  • 1099INT and 1099DIV Interest and Dividends
  • 1099B Brokerage Statement (APPOINTMENT MUST BE AFTER MARCH 15th )
  • 1099MISC Miscellaneous Income
  • 1099NEC Non-Employee Compensation
  • Alimony, Date of divorce, amount, former spouse full name, former spouse SS#
  • Form 1444 Stimulus Payments received
  • 1098-T Education, Tuition
  • Dependent/Childcare-Provider’s name, address, EIN #, amount paid for each child
  • Rent-Landlord’s name, address, phone #, amount paid-For Property Tax Relied Credit
  • Proof of Health Insurance-1095A if from the marketplace/Healthsource RI
  • Covid-19 Sick Leave, Family Leave information, if applicable
